Block Pavers Installation in Boston, MA
Block pavers installation services involve the placement of interlocking bricks or stones to create durable, attractive surfaces for driveways, walkways, patios, and other outdoor areas. This type of project typically includes preparing the ground, laying the pavers in desired patterns, and ensuring proper edging and leveling for a long-lasting finish. Homeowners often request this service to enhance curb appeal, improve functionality, or replace existing surfaces with a more resilient and visually appealing option.
Property owners considering block pavers installation usually want to understand the scope of the project, including material options, design possibilities, and the durability of different paving styles. It's also important to consider the condition of the existing surface, drainage requirements, and maintenance needs. Clear communication about these factors can help ensure the completed project meets expectations and adds value to the property.

Block Pavers Installation Questions
What are block pavers typically used for? Block pavers are commonly used for driveways, walkways, patios, and outdoor seating areas due to their durability and aesthetic appeal.
How long does a block paver installation usually take? Installation times vary based on project size, but most residential projects are completed within a few days.
Are block pavers su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, block pavers are designed to withstand heavy foot and vehicle traffic when properly installed.
What maintenance is needed for block pavers? Regular cleaning and occasional resealing help maintain the appearance and longevity of block pavers.
